  1. ok... I'm using Virtual Dub, and have succesfully added my filters for subtitleing, converted my .srt file to .ssa, and i can even see a preview of how it looks!

    The problem i am having, is with saving the file. The file when loaded is in .avi format, and i wish to keep it this way, but with the subtitles now added.

    IF i try direct streaming copy (which is what I'm used to), it wont let me save it with the subtitles added in.

    The only thing i could think of doing was re-proccessing it.. so i chose dIVX format.. and im looking at 10 hours to do this!

    does anyone know how i can save the file the same as its origional, but with the subtitles turned on... in a quick amount of time?
